Latest Patents

Among his latest patents is a groundbreaking "Prosthetic attachment device for osseointegrated implants." This technology introduces a quick disconnect and overload protection mechanism for prosthetic limbs that utilize osseointegrated percutaneous posts. The design allows users to don and doff their prosthetic limb with great ease. Furthermore, it features a resettable torsional overload protection mechanism and a fusible link designed to safeguard the osseointegrated post from both axial and bending over-loads.

Drew's patent titled "Joint implants having porous structures formed utilizing additive manufacturing and related systems and methods" represents another significant contribution. This medical implant incorporates a porous lattice structure, created using additive manufacturing techniques, such as direct metal laser sintering. The process involves crafting a CAD model of the porous lattice by defining a trimming volume and merging lattice elements with adjacent solid substrates.
